Pokemon Card Symbol Meanings – Common Symbols

“Common” cards are the most frequently found cards in booster packs. These cards feature a small black circle or dot located next to the card number, which you can find at the bottom of the card, typically in one of the corners. Though not particularly rare or sought after, common cards form the foundation of any Pokémon TCG deck.

Pokemon Card Symbol Meanings – Uncommon Symbols

Taking a step up from common cards, we have the “uncommon” cards. They are represented by a black diamond symbol located next to the card number. You can generally expect a 2:1 ratio of common-to-uncommon cards in any mint Pokémon TCG deck. While not wildly rare, these cards can offer more strategic options in gameplay.

Pokemon Card Symbol Meanings – Rare Symbols

“Rare” cards are where the real excitement begins. These cards are represented by a black star symbol located next to the card number. Rare Pokémon cards offer powerful abilities and unique artwork, making them highly desirable to collectors and players alike.

Pokemon Card Symbol Meanings – Basic Energy Symbols

Basic Energy Symbols represent the energy required for a Pokémon to use its attacks. Here’s a quick rundown of what each symbol represents:

  • G: Grass Energy
  • R: Fire Energy
  • W: Water Energy
  • L: Lightning Energy
  • P: Psychic Energy
  • F: Fighting Energy
  • C: Colorless Energy

Pokemon Card Symbol Meanings – Supporter Symbols

Supporter symbols are the third type of Trainer Card symbols you’ll come across. Supporter cards provide potent effects; however, you can only use one Supporter card per turn. Here are a few examples:

  • Professor Oak’s Setup: Helps you play three Basic Pokémon from your deck directly onto your Bench
  • Cynthia: Shuffle your hand into your deck and draw six more cards
  • Guzma & Hala: Search for a Stadium card and special energy cards from your deck

Pokemon Card Symbol Meanings – Pokemon Retreat Cost Symbols

Retreat cost symbols indicate the number of energy cards a Pokémon needs to be discarded in order to retreat from an active position to the bench. These symbols are represented by small energy icons near the bottom of the card.

Managing your Pokémon’s retreat cost is an essential part of the game, as it allows you to swap out weakened or disadvantaged Pokémon for more suitable ones in the heat of battle.
